函数:1.定义:def 函数名(参数),返回值return可有可无,没有时默认返回None,  函数名是区分大小写的,函数名必须以下划线或字母开头,  可以包含任意字母、数字或下划线的组合。不能使用任何的标点符号;2.变量:  全局变量:作用域从定义开始到进程结束。    局部变量:作用域和生存周期仅在从定义开始到函数结束。 如果想在函数内部定义全局变量,就要先声明是
Python中,logging模块提供了一个灵活的日志记录系统,用于将程序的输出信息分门别类地发送到不同的目的地。Logger对象是这个系统的核心,它负责创建日志消息。默认情况下,如果没有特别配置,Logger会将日志输出到标准错误输出(stderr)。日志的输出位置可以通过配置Logger的处理器(Handler)和格式化器(Formatter)来改变。Python logging模块支持多种
一、简单将日志打印到屏幕:[python] view plaincopy 1. import logging 2. logging.debug('debug message') 3. logging.info('info message') 4. logging.warning('warning message') 5. logging.error('error mess
转载 1月前
330阅读
我们在写程序的时候经常会打一些日志来帮助我们查找问题,这次学习一下logging模块,在python里面如何操作日志。介绍一下logging模块,logging模块就是python里面用来操作日志的模块,logging模块中主要有4个类,分别负责不同的工作:Logger 记录器,暴露了应用程序代码能直接使用的接口;简单点说就是一个创建一个办公室,让人在里头工作 Handler 处理器,将
介绍 logging模块是Python内置的标准模块,主要用于输入运行日志,可以设置输出日志的等级,日志保存路径等。
pythonlogging模块配置文件的格式 2008/01/08 16:48 ==================================== pythonlogging模块配置文件的格式 ==================================== :原文url: http://docs.python.org/l
转载 2023-12-07 15:23:46
90阅读
python logging模块使用 logging模块 日志记录的重要性 logging的工作框图 Logger:即 Logger Main Class,是我们进行日志记录时创建的对象,我们可以调用它的方法传入日志模板和信息,来生成一条条日志记录,称作 Log Record。 Log Record
转载 2019-05-14 00:33:00
147阅读
2评论
日志记录是一项重要的应用程序开发任务,它可以帮助开发人员了解应用程序的运行情况、发现错误和警告等信息。Python 为此提供了一个名为 logging 的强大模块,可以用于记录日志和管理日志。 在本文中,我们将介绍 Python logging 模块的一些基本用法、重要概念以及如何在 Python 应用程序中使用它。 简介 Python logging 模块是用于创建、记录和存储应用程序日志的标准
原创 2023-06-23 08:58:52
95阅读
1点赞
#coding: UTF-8'''Created on 2014年1月6日@author: mingliu'''import logging#导入mylog = logging.getLogger('mylogger')#申请一个名字otherlog = logging.getLogger('mylogger')#同一个工程下面全部logger全可以统一根据名字获得,享用相同配置mylog.set
原创 2014-01-06 20:04:43
729阅读
#python logging模块使用 ##学习完本篇,你将会 理解什么是日志 了解Logger各个模块功能 掌握Logger配置
原创 2024-10-21 14:59:51
22阅读
这篇文章主要参考:
原创 2022-05-05 21:45:27
332阅读
1. 简单配置使用logging.basicConfig进行配置#!/usr/local/bin/python# -*- coding:utf-8 -*-import logging # 通过下面的方式进行简单配置输出方式与日志级别logging.basicConfig(filename='logger.log', level=logging.INFO) logging.debug('debug message')logging.info('info message')logging.
logging.basicConfig( level=logging.INFO, format='%(asctime)s - %(threadName)s - %(p
原创 2022-09-19 10:14:58
87阅读
# 实现“python logging 全局 按照日期生成文件”教程 ## 整体流程 首先,我们需要导入logging模块,并进行全局配置,以便在整个程序中使用。然后,我们需要设置日志文件按照日期生成,以便对日志进行归档和管理。 ```python import logging import os from logging.handlers import TimedRotatingFileH
原创 2024-03-20 07:14:09
329阅读
在开发程序过程中,打一手好的日志,对我们事后追根索源,排查问题至关重要. 在初学c或者python时,我们的代码中通常充斥着这样的代码片段:printf("a is %d",a);或者print 'Start reading database' records = model.read_recrods() print '# records', records print 'Updating re
转载 2024-05-16 06:15:39
25阅读
  最近想将自己写的py文件打包成可运行的程序,上网查了后,目前有好几种方法可以将python文件打包成exe应用程序文件,例如py2exe,pyinstaller等,比较下来,还是觉得pyinstaller使用起来比较简单。1、首先第一步下载安装pyinstaller,如果已经安装过python3的用户比较方便,可以使用python3文件下的Scripts文件中的pip安装,python2好像没
转载 2024-06-26 23:36:16
10阅读
#!/usr/bin/env python # encoding: utf-8 import logging #定义handler的输出格式 formatter=logging.Formatter('%(asctime)s--%(name)s--%(filename)s--%(message)s') #创建一个handler,用于写入日志文件,只输出debu
原创 精选 2017-03-02 15:30:15
4834阅读
Python LOGGING使用方法 1. 简介 使用场景 日志的严重程度 由高到低| Level|| : || CRITICAL|| ERROR|| WARNING|| INFO|| DEBUG|logging默认的严重程度是WARNING,即在这个严重程度或以上的日志才会被记录。 有两种常用的记
转载 2018-12-27 21:56:00
136阅读
2评论
logging 是线程安全的,也就是说,在一个进程内的多个线程同时往同一个文件写日志是安全的。但是多个进程往同一
转载 2021-12-31 16:13:21
43阅读
# Python logging 使用示例yaml 在Python中,logging是一个非常强大和灵活的日志记录工具。通过使用logging模块,我们可以轻松记录程序运行时的各种信息,包括错误、警告、调试信息等。在本文中,我们将介绍如何使用logging模块以及如何通过yaml配置文件来配置日志记录。 ## 使用logging模块记录日志 首先,让我们来看一个简单的示例,展示如何使用log
原创 2024-06-14 04:08:15
86阅读
  • 1
  • 2
  • 3
  • 4
  • 5